The Atkins diet is probably the most well known of the low carb diet plans. It was made famous by Dr. Robert Atkins who taught that obesity in Western countries was caused by consumption of refined carbohydrates (specifically sugar, flour and high-fructose corn syrup) in the foods we eat. He also advocated that saturated fats were not as much of a problem in your diet as trans fats.
As such, the Atkins plan is filled with red meat, eggs, chicken - pretty much any meat you can think of. The one thing that is missing are the servings of fruits and vegetables.
